About Cádiz

Cádiz sits on a spit of land with the Atlantic on three sides, which means light from every direction and a horizon at the end of most streets. La Caleta beach, framed by two old forts, is where the city watches the sun go down. The old town is a dense grid of tall, pale houses and watchtowers, with small squares full of laurel trees. It is less visited by international travellers than Seville or Granada, which shows in the photographs — fewer crowds in frame, and a working coastal city rather than a monument.

What are the best photo spots in Cádiz?

La Caleta beach, framed between the castles of Santa Catalina and San Sebastián, is the city's own postcard. Beyond it: the Playa de la Caleta promenade, the cathedral's golden dome seen from the Campo del Sur seafront, the Torre Tavira and the watchtower rooftops, the laurel trees of the Plaza de Mina, and the Genovés park with its palms.

What's the best time of day for photos in Cádiz?

With the Atlantic on three sides there is light from every direction, and La Caleta faces west, which is unusual on this coast and makes sunset the obvious slot. The one thing to plan around is the levante, the hard easterly wind that also defines Tarifa down the coast: it can blow for days, whipping sand along the beaches. Spring and autumn are the calmest seasons.

Where do we watch the sunset in Cádiz for photos?

La Caleta is where the city itself goes: a small west-facing bay held between two forts, with the causeway to San Sebastián running out into the water. It is a working city beach and busy in summer, so arrive early for space. The Campo del Sur seafront and the walls at the Baluarte de la Candelaria are quieter alternatives with the same light.

Do I need a permit to elope in Spain?

For a symbolic ceremony (non-legal), you generally don't need permits for most public outdoor locations like beaches, parks, and viewpoints, though some specific sites like the cigarrales of Toledo or Park Güell in Barcelona may require advance booking or a small access fee. Private venues like wine estates or boutique hotels typically include ceremony permissions in their rental fee. For a legally binding ceremony, you'll need to register at a local civil registry office (Registro Civil) and provide documentation including birth certificates and proof of single status translated into Spanish. The process takes 2-4 weeks.
